Episode 49 Podcast starts off with a review and rating of Predators which is currently playing at most theaters. The film stars Adrien Brody and Alice Braga, along with a brief role for Laurence Fishburne. An alien race captures several humans and whisks them away to another planet where they are hunted as game.
The second review this week is for Beyond The Darkness, an Italian film that has an alternative title of Buio Omega. This was released yesterday on DVD and BluRay as a double-disc set. Directed by the famous Joe D’Amato this movie is about a 22 year old guy who lost his fiance and turns into a cannibalistic serial killer with the help of the house maid.
